This well-presented two-bedroom mid-townhouse is the perfect home for first-time buyers looking to step onto the property ladder, a small family in search of a comfortable home, or savvy landlords seeking a fantastic investment opportunity. Offered with no upward chain, this home is ready for immediate occupation, making your move smooth and hassle-free.
Step into the entrance hall, where the stairs take you up to the first floor, and a door leads into the good-size lounge with a lovely bay window at the front, letting in plenty of natural light.
To the rear, the modern kitchen/breakfast room boasts a stylish range of contemporary cabinets, complemented by marble-effect work surfaces. A breakfast bar area provides the perfect spot for casual dining, while an understairs storage cupboard ensures practicality. From here, step through to the conservatory, a fantastic addition that enhances the living space, offering French doors leading to the rear garden - ideal for relaxing or entertaining.
Ascending to the first floor, the spacious main bedroom benefits from a built-in wardrobe and an additional storage cupboard. A second bedroom provides flexibility as a guest room, home office, or nursery. The modern family bathroom is well-appointed with stylish fixtures and fittings, offering a fresh and contemporary feel.
Externally, the property enjoys a driveway to the front, providing convenient off-road parking, along with a small gravelled garden area for easy maintenance. The rear garden has been designed for minimal upkeep, featuring a paved patio, artificial lawn, and tiered garden areas, perfect for outdoor relaxation or entertaining guests.
Situated in a highly convenient area, the property enjoys excellent access to local amenities, including shops, schools and parks. Commuters will appreciate the proximity to major road links, ensuring convenient travel to surrounding areas.
